Perché il mio telefono Android non è ancora aggiornato?

Perché il mio telefono Android non è ancora aggiornato? / androide

Android 5.0 Lollipop è stato rilasciato a novembre. A febbraio, tre mesi dopo, TechCrunch ha riferito che meno del 2% dei dispositivi Android lo eseguiva. Ora, a marzo, il numero si aggira ancora intorno al 3%.

Confronta questo al rivale principale di Android. Apple ha rilasciato iOS 8.0 a settembre iOS 8 è qui: 10 motivi per installarlo subito iOS 8 è qui: 10 motivi per installarlo subito Se possiedi un iPhone, iPad o iPod Touch, ti consigliamo di aggiornarlo a iOS 8 il più presto possibile. Ecco perché. Leggi di più e entro novembre, solo due mesi dopo, oltre il 60% degli iPhone eseguiva l'ultima versione, e in realtà è così lento quando guardi al tasso di adozione delle versioni precedenti di iOS.

Cosa dà? Perché i dispositivi Android si aggiornano alla versione più recente molto più lentamente dei loro concorrenti? Perché non lo è il tuo dispositivo che esegue ancora Lollipop?

Il problema è il design di Android

A quanto pare, il problema del lancio lento dell'aggiornamento e dell'adozione degli aggiornamenti ancora più lento non è una novità quando si guarda alla cronologia delle versioni di Android. Abbiamo esaminato l'adozione della versione frammentata di Android Una guida rapida alle versioni e agli aggiornamenti di Android [Android] Una guida rapida alle versioni e agli aggiornamenti di Android [Android] Se qualcuno ti dice che stanno eseguendo Android, non stanno dicendo quanto avresti pensare. A differenza dei principali sistemi operativi per computer, Android è un sistema operativo ampio che copre numerose versioni e piattaforme. Se desideri ... Leggi di più nel lontano 2011, ma da allora è cambiato pochissimo.

Il problema deriva dalla filosofia di progettazione principale di Android: un ambiente aperto che può essere adattato e personalizzato e presentato da chiunque sia in grado di produrre un telefono. Questa apertura è uno dei maggiori punti di vendita di Android perché gli utenti Android amano la libertà, ma ha alcuni grossi problemi, come la pirateria delle app Android Piracy su Android: quanto è grave? Pirateria su Android: quanto è grave? Android è noto per la sua sfrenata pirateria, quindi esaminiamo esattamente quanto sia grave. Leggi di più .

Nonostante sia ufficialmente disponibile a novembre, Lollipop era effettivamente disponibile solo per alcuni dispositivi Nexus al momento. Perché? Perché i produttori adottano e sviluppano gli aggiornamenti al loro ritmo, che è anche il motivo per cui gli stessi produttori hanno annunciato stime di disponibilità Lollipop Android 5.0 Lollipop: cosa è e quando lo otterrete Android 5.0 Lollipop: che cos'è e quando lo otterrete Android 5.0 Lollipop è qui, ma solo su dispositivi Nexus. Che cosa c'è di nuovo in questo sistema operativo e quando puoi aspettarti che arrivi sul tuo dispositivo? Leggi di più .

Al contrario, iOS è un singolo ecosistema strettamente mantenuto e regolato da Apple. Non devono preoccuparsi delle versioni HTC, Samsung e Motorola dell'iPhone; piuttosto, ogni dato iPhone è lo stesso del prossimo, quindi gli aggiornamenti sono più facili da testare e più veloci da spingere.

E davvero, questo è ciò a cui tutti questi rallentamenti Android si riducono: il numero di dispositivi che devono essere supportati.

Tutto inizia con Google ...

Diciamo che tu ed i tuoi due amici comprate ciascuno lo stesso kit LEGO. Google annuncia il nuovo progetto LEGO: Build with Chrome Google annuncia il nuovo progetto LEGO: Build with Chrome Mai voluto costruire qualcosa con i LEGO ma evitare il pericolo di calpestare uno di quei piedi -destroyers? Bene, il team di Chrome e LEGO Group hanno una sorpresa per te: Build With Chrome. Per saperne di più (che può essere effettivamente utilizzato in modo produttivo Come utilizzare i LEGO per gestire meglio il tuo tempo Come utilizzare i LEGO per gestire meglio il tuo tempo Penso di aver trovato lo strumento di massima produttività: i LEGO. spiega, leggi di più) e usalo per creare una creazione unica. Alcuni mesi dopo, LEGO rilascia un altro kit e tutti voi tre lo acquistate in modo da poter migliorare ciò che avete già fatto.

Ognuno di voi deve incorporare quei nuovi pezzi, ma il processo sarà diverso per ognuno di voi perché le vostre creazioni sono tutte costruite in modi diversi. tu potrebbe essere facile adattarsi, ma i tuoi amici potrebbe lottare e impiegare più tempo per farlo funzionare.

Ma prima di approfondire la questione, diamo un'occhiata a ciò che serve per produrre quei nuovi kit LEGO (leggi: nuove versioni di Android) in primo luogo.

Google lavora sulle prossime versioni di Android dietro le quinte. Una volta annunciata una nuova versione al pubblico, Google fornisce il codice sorgente per tale versione sul proprio sito Web in modo che i vettori e i produttori possano valutarlo e decidere quali dispositivi supporteranno il nuovo aggiornamento.

Osservando lo schema della sua storia, Google tende ad annunciare nuove versioni Android ogni 6-12 mesi, spesso favorendo il rilascio tra luglio e novembre ma a volte scegliendo di deviare se le circostanze lo richiedono.

Una volta che il codice sorgente è disponibile, spetta ai produttori ottenerlo confezionato e pronto per i clienti in modo tempestivo.

... E finisce con i vettori

Poco più di un anno fa, HTC ha rilasciato un'infografica che dettaglia il processo elaborato necessario per trasformare una nuova versione di Android in qualcosa che può essere trasferito su dispositivi attuali.

Tornando all'analogia LEGO, diciamo che sei HTC e hai bisogno di incorporare questi nuovi pezzi LEGO in ciò che hai già costruito. Per questo, è necessario parlare con i corrieri e vedere cosa essi volere.

Forse AT & T vuole pezzi A, B e C nei loro dispositivi mentre T-Mobile vuole pezzi X, Y e Z nel loro. Ci sono oltre 100 vettori in tutto il mondo e ognuno desidera qualcosa di diverso. Come HTC, dovrai adattarne molti, il che significa costruire e testare centinaia di varianti.

Una volta che i bug vengono schiacciati (e credimi, ci sarà abbondanza di bug in tutto il processo), tali dispositivi devono essere approvati da tali operatori, oltre a Google, insieme a qualsiasi altro organismo di regolamentazione specifico per regione.

Quando tutto è pronto e concluso, HTC può finalmente preparare i propri server over-the-air (OTA) con tutti questi aggiornamenti specifici del dispositivo. Una volta che i server sono pronti, gli utenti HTC ricevono una notifica di un aggiornamento disponibile che può essere scaricato e applicato.

Altri produttori operano in modo simile.

Come puoi vedere, è un processo complesso che richiede molto tempo grazie ai numerosi scambi avanti e indietro tra tutte le richieste, i test e le iterazioni che sono comuni a qualsiasi processo di sviluppo del software Cosa fa realmente il "Software Beta" Significare? Cosa significa realmente "software beta"? Cosa significa per un progetto essere in beta e dovrebbe interessarti? Leggi di più .

Quale versione di Android stai utilizzando?

Allora perché il tuo dispositivo Android non è ancora aggiornato? Forse il tuo modello particolare non supporta l'ultima versione, ma la spiegazione più probabile è che devi solo aspettare ancora un po '.

Il lento processo di implementazione di Android ti infastidisce? È sufficiente per farti passare a iOS? O sei contento di sopportarlo? Condividi i tuoi pensieri con noi nei commenti qui sotto!

Crediti immagine: sala d'attesa Via Shutterstock, pila di telefoni Android Via Shutterstock, telefono Android di base Via Shutterstock, processo di aggiornamento HTC Infographic

Scopri di più su: Personalizzazione Android, Software Updater.